Cel: P047a & p0401
Just got a check engine light on our 2009 Sportwagen. I did a quick search and on this forum and came up with nothing. Does anyone have a clue? Looks like the Exhaust pressure sensor 2 is shorted. I'm going to clear it and see if it comes back. Here is what it reads from VCDS:
2 Faults Found:
001146 - Exhaust Pressure Sensor 2: Open Circuit
P047A - 000 - - - MIL ON

Damn, wish I saw this earlier. I had a CEL a while ago and bought a VAGCOM and service manual because of it. No help from here unfortunately--no one knew what the problem was.
Turns out that sensor was the problem. Replaced it myself--but it was sort of difficult.
Turns out that the sensors (exhaust pressure sensor 2) that they put in some if not all of the TDIs here are actually sensors that haven been discontinued for years--at least in Europe. Knowing that, I'd say its safe to assume it's because they're prone to failure.

For anyone who is interested in replacing the pressure sensor #2 the part# is : 076-906-051-A SENSOR. The price on my invoice from the dealership was $72.61 in March of 2011.
